Direct Measurement of Kinetic Force Generated by Mycoplasma

Methods Mol Biol. 2023:2646:337-346. doi: 10.1007/978-1-0716-3060-0_28.

Abstract

Optical tweezers enable us to measure the force generated by bacterial motility and motor proteins. Here, we describe a method, using optical tweezers and related techniques, to measure the force generated during Mycoplasma gliding. An avidin-conjugated polystyrene bead trapped by a focused laser beam is bound to the surface-biotinylated Mycoplasma cell, which pulls the bead from the trap center of the laser. The force generated by Mycoplasma is calculated from a displacement measured and a spring constant of the laser trap.
